Key Ingredients & Substitutions

All-Purpose Flour: This is the base for your cookies. While all-purpose flour works great, you can substitute whole wheat flour for a nuttier taste. Gluten-free flour blends are also an option for those avoiding gluten.

Powdered Sugar: This gives a nice sweetness and smooth texture. If you’re looking for a healthier option, you can use coconut sugar or make your own powdered sugar by blending granulated sugar until fine.

Unsalted Butter: Softened butter helps create a tender cookie. If you’re dairy-free, coconut oil or vegan butter can be used as a substitute.

Cream Cheese: The creamy topping is essential! Either regular or low-fat cream cheese works. For a vegan option, try a plant-based cream cheese alternative which is widely available.

Fruits: Using assorted fruits not only adds flavor but also makes the cookies colorful. Feel free to mix in fruits like bananas, peaches, or even pineapple based on seasonality and your personal taste!

How Can I Ensure My Cookies Are Soft and Delicious?

One of the keys to making these cookies soft is in the mixing and baking. Here are some tips:

  • Make sure your butter is softened, not melted—which helps when creaming with sugar.
  • Don’t overmix your dough; just blend until combined. This keeps the cookies light.
  • Keep an eye on baking time. Remove them from the oven when the edges are golden; they’ll continue to firm up while cooling.

Lastly, allow the cookies to cool completely before adding the cream cheese layer. This helps the cream cheese spread properly without melting!

How to Make Fruit Pizza Cookies

Ingredients You’ll Need:

For the Cookie Base:

  • 1 ½ cups all-purpose flour
  • ½ cup powdered sugar
  • ½ c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 1 large egg
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• ½ teaspoon baking powder
  • ÂĽ teaspoon salt

For the Cream Cheese Layer:

  • 1 cup cream cheese, softened
  • ½ cup granulated sugar
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ract (for cream cheese mixture)

For Topping:

  • Assorted fresh fruits (such as strawberries, blueberries, raspberries, kiwi, and mandarin oranges)
  • Optional: mint leaves for garnish

How Much Time Will You Need?

This recipe will take about 15 minutes of prep time, plus 10-12 minutes for baking, and you may want to chill the cookies until you’re ready to serve. Overall, plan for about 30-40 minutes from start to finish!

Step-by-Step Instructions:

1. Preheat and Prepare

First, let’s get your oven ready! Preheat it to 350°F (175°C). While the oven is warming up, line a baking sheet with parchment paper so the cookies don’t stick.

2. Make the Cookie Dough

In a medium bowl, cream together the softened butter and powdered sugar using a mixer or a whisk until it’s light and fluffy. This will take a couple of minutes. Next, beat in the egg and the first teaspoon of vanilla extract until everything is mixed well.

3. Combine Dry Ingredients

In another bowl, mix the flour, baking powder, and salt together. Gradually add this dry mixture to the wet ingredients, stirring until a soft dough forms. It should be smooth and easy to handle!

4. Shape the Cookies

Roll the dough into small balls, about 1.5 inches in diameter. Place them on your prepared baking sheet, leaving some space between each ball. Flatten each ball gently using the bottom of a glass or your hand so that they spread out while baking.

5. Bake the Cookies

Now it’s time to bake! Place the baking sheet in the oven and bake for about 10-12 minutes, or until the edges of the cookies are lightly golden. Once done, take them out and let them cool completely on a wire rack.

6. Prepare the Cream Cheese Mixture

While the cookies are cooling, mix the softened cream cheese, granulated sugar, and the second teaspoon of vanilla extract in a separate bowl. Beat it until it’s smooth and creamy. This will be the delicious layer on top of the cookies!

7. Assemble the Cookies

When the cookies are completely cool, spread a generous layer of your cream cheese mixture on each cookie. Don’t be shy! Use as much as you like.

8. Add Fresh Fruits

Time to decorate! Top the cream cheese layer with your assortment of fresh fruits. You can arrange them however you like—be creative!

9. Garnish and Serve

If you want to make them extra special, you can add mint leaves for garnish. Serve the cookies right away or chill them in the refrigerator until you’re ready to enjoy them. They’re refreshing and perfect for any occasion!

Can I Substitute the All-Purpose Flour?

Yes, you can use a gluten-free all-purpose flour blend if you’re looking for a gluten-free option. Just be sure that the blend you choose contains xanthan gum to help with the dough’s texture. Consult the package for any specific measurements or adjustments needed.

How Do I Store Leftover Fruit Pizza Cookies?

To store leftovers, place them in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. If you’re concerned about the fruits getting soggy, it’s best to assemble the cookies just before serving or keep the cream cheese spread and fruit separate until then.

Can I Make the Dough Ahead of Time?

Absolutely! You can prepare the dough in advance and refrigerate it for up to 2 days before baking. Just wrap it tightly in plastic wrap. If you’re using refrigerated dough, let it sit at room temperature for about 10-15 minutes to soften slightly before rolling into balls.

What Other Fruits Can I Use on My Cookies?

Feel free to get creative with the toppings! Other delicious fruit options include sliced bananas, peaches, or even pomegranate seeds. Just ensure that your fruit choices are fresh and complement the cream cheese flavor well!
